The Grinnell College softball team looks to continue its winning ways on Wednesday with a non-conference doubleheader at Cornell. Grinnell has won six of its last seven games and have done so without a power game.Grinnell coach Tom Sonnichson says they don’t have people who can crush the ball, so they’ll have to manufacture runs. He says they will be able to put pressure on defenses with their running game. He says they’ve never had this much team speed in the past.After opening the season with four losses the Pioneers are now 6-5.
